Advertisement
Guest User

Untitled

a guest
Jun 2nd, 2017
55
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 0.99 KB | None | 0 0
  1.  
  2. # DELETE THIS SHIET!!!
  3. import ssl
  4. ssl._create_default_https_context = ssl._create_unverified_context
  5. # DELETE THIS SHIET!!!
  6.  
  7. def cabinet_login(username, password):
  8. url = u"https://94.137.226.5:12500/emr/token"
  9. print url
  10.  
  11. post_data = {
  12. u"userName": username,
  13. u"password": password,
  14. u"grant_type": u"password",
  15. }
  16. # post_data = json.dumps(post_data)
  17. # post_data = "userName=%s&password=%s&grant_type=%s" % (username, password, 'password',)
  18. print post_data
  19.  
  20. handler = urllib2.HTTPHandler(debuglevel=1)
  21. opener = urllib2.build_opener(handler)
  22. urllib2.install_opener(opener)
  23. opener.addheaders.append((
  24. u"Content-Type",
  25. u"application/x-www-form-urlencoded",
  26. ))
  27.  
  28. print 'ohmy!'
  29. print urllib.urlencode(post_data)
  30. req = urllib2.Request(url, urllib.urlencode(post_data))
  31. content = opener.open(req)
  32. response = json.loads(content.read())
  33.  
  34. print response.info()
  35.  
  36. return response
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ement